Premis successfully delivered a significant redevelopment project for our long-standing client, Ramsay Health Care, under a Design and Construct Contract. This ambitious project involved reconfiguring and partially demolishing and rebuilding the existing footprint to create three state-of-the-art theatres alongside modern ancillary facilities. The primary objective was to enhance the hospital’s capacity and functionality, resulting in a contemporary, efficient, and patient-focused environment.
The project encompassed a full fitout of three modern operating theatres, comprehensive service upgrades across all disciplines including electrical, mechanical, and plumbing systems, and the development of essential ancillary spaces. These included a new reception area, sterile store, PWD-compliant toilets and showers, pre-op and recovery areas, and a medical store. Additionally, a rooftop plant deck was installed with acoustic louvres to minimise noise for surrounding residents, and the existing plant room was upgraded to support the hospital’s enhanced infrastructure.
The project was executed in three carefully planned stages. Stage 1 addressed dislocated spaces by upgrading minor ancillary areas. In Stage 2, one operational theatre was maintained while hoarding containment zones were installed to isolate construction areas, ensuring minimal disruption to hospital operations. Stage 3 involved taking full possession of the site to carry out demolition, rebuild, and a comprehensive fitout.
Challenges included spatial constraints that required innovative coordination to fit modern services within existing ceiling cavities, and geotechnical issues due to the site’s location at the bottom of the water table, necessitating structural redesigns to address soft spots. Operating within a live hospital environment also required complex logistics, extensive communication, and careful planning to minimise disruption while maintaining patient care and safety.
Despite these complexities, Premis successfully delivered the project on the contractual Practical Completion date of 20/12/24.
